Throwing non-veg food waste in Ganga could hurt religious sentiments: Allahabad HC on iftar party row

The Allahabad High Court granted bail to five individuals accused of discarding non-vegetarian food waste into the River Ganga. The court noted that such actions could offend Hindu religious sentiments. The accused expressed regret and promised not to repeat the act. The incident occurred during an iftar party on a boat in Varanasi.
